TopSlot Site 2025 - Premium Slots Experience

3000+ Latest Casino Games – Click to Play

Casino Games Preview

Visit TopSlots – Explore Over 3000 Casino Games

Info

Info

Top Online Slot Site UK

The Pros and Cons

Top Slots Related Posts
Scroll to Top